mp3 player question


dmesg



Initializing USB Mass Storage driver...
usbcore: registered new driver usb-storage
USB Mass Storage support registered.
usb 2-2: new full speed USB device using address 2
scsi0 : SCSI emulation for USB Mass Storage devices
Vendor: Rio Model: Carbon Rev: 0150
Type: Direct-Access ANSI SCSI revision: 02
SCSI device sda: 9761374 512-byte hdwr sectors (4998 MB)
sda: assuming Write Enabled
sda: assuming drive cache: write through
sda: sda1
Attached scsi removable disk sda at scsi0, channel 0, id 0, lun 0
USB Mass Storage device found at 2
usb 2-2: USB disconnect, address 2
usb 2-2: new full speed USB device using address 3
scsi1 : SCSI emulation for USB Mass Storage devices
Vendor: Rio Model: Carbon Rev: 0150
Type: Direct-Access ANSI SCSI revision: 02
SCSI device sda: 9761374 512-byte hdwr sectors (4998 MB)
sda: assuming Write Enabled
sda: assuming drive cache: write through
sda: sda1
Attached scsi removable disk sda at scsi1, channel 0, id 0, lun 0
USB Mass Storage device found at 3

Ok I have a folder named mp3drive located in my mnt folder. I made the necessary changes to my fstab. I also was able to mount this drive. My question is how do i get files to and from this drive its a Rio carbon with a 5gb usb-storage. Wanna put some mp3's on this puppy thats located in another folder how do i transfer them on there etc and get it to read the mp3's that are already on my mp3 player?

If you mounted the device on /mnt/mp3drive, then to copy files to it, simply type cp filename /mnt/mp3drive in your terminal, to just move files there, use mv filename /mnt/mp3drive. To play files on there, open up your favorite mp3 program, and open the files in /mnt/mp3drive. This is all, of course, assuming you've given yourself proper permissions.
